Kenneth MORATTI Obituary

MORATTI,
Kenneth George (KG):
Passed away peacefully on Saturday 28 August 2021, aged 88 years. Dearly loved husband of the late Audrey and in later years loved partner of Diane. Awesome father of Graham (Fred) and Jan, Des (Pogal) and Lindy, Kelvin (Pop) (deceased) and Janine, Trevor (Billy) and Fi, Neville (Boo) and Michelle, Karen (Crippens) and Mike. Adored grandfather and great-grandfather.
Forever in our hearts.
Messages to the Moratti Family may be left on Ken's tribute page at eagars.co.nz/ken. Due to the current Covid-19 restrictions a private service to celebrate Ken's life will be held.

Published by Taranaki Daily News on Aug. 30, 2021.
